    Default user management with ldap integration

    im running a fresh install of 4.5... AD integration is working just fine.

    my question comes to user management. how do i add permissions to the AD created user(s)?
    in the picture below, you'll see that there is no way to edit the srvadmin account (ad account)

    any ideas?

    Default Re: user management with ldap integration

    Your user must not have had a name in the LDAP directory? You will probably have to edit the database directly using something like PhpMyAdmin to modify the users table. Toggle the is_admin column and add a first or last name for the user in question.
